Overview
Optimized JSON (Oj), as the name implies was written to provide speed optimized JSON handling.
Oj uses modes to control how object are encoded and decoded. In addition global and options to methods allow additional behavior modifications. The modes are:
-
:strict mode will only allow the 7 basic JSON types to be serialized. Any other Object will raise an Exception.
-
:null mode is similar to the :strict mode except any Object that is not one of the JSON base types is replaced by a JSON null.
-
:object mode will dump any Object as a JSON Object with keys that match the Ruby Object's variable names without the '@' character. This is the highest performance mode.
-
:compat or :json mode is the compatible mode for the json gem. It mimics the json gem including the options, defaults, and restrictions.
-
:rails is the compatibility mode for Rails or Active support.
-
:custom is the most configurable mode.
-
:wab specifically for WAB data exchange.

.to_json(obj, options) ⇒ Object
Dumps an Object (obj) to a string. If the object has a to_json method that will be called. The mode is set to :compat.
- obj [Object] Object to serialize as an JSON document String
-
options [Hash]
- :max_nesting [Fixnum|boolean] It true nesting is limited to 100. If a Fixnum nesting is set to the provided value. The option to detect circular references is available but is not compatible with the json gem., default is false or unlimited.
- :allow_nan [boolean] If true non JSON compliant words such as Nan and Infinity will be used as appropriate, default is true.
- :quirks_mode [boolean] Allow single JSON values instead of documents, default is true (allow).
- :indent [String|nil] String to use for indentation, overriding the indent option if not nil.
- :space [String|nil] String to use for the space after the colon in JSON object fields.
- :space_before [String|nil] String to use before the colon separator in JSON object fields.
- :object_nl [String|nil] String to use after a JSON object field value.
- :array_nl [String|nil] String to use after a JSON array value.
- :trace [Boolean] If true trace is turned on.
Returns [String] the encoded JSON.
